Overview
As a Compliance and Corporate Social Responsibility Intern, you will support Brightstar Lottery’s commitment to integrity, transparency, and responsible play. This internship offers hands-on experience in compliance documentation, policy research, and responsible gaming initiatives within a highly regulated lottery environment. You will work cross-functionally with Compliance, Legal, Marketing, and CSR partners to support regulatory readiness and Positive Play efforts. The internship is full-time during the summer and follows a hybrid model that includes both remote work and on-site collaboration.
Responsibilities
Compliance & Policy Support
- Assist with drafting, reviewing, and maintaining internal compliance and CSR policies
- Research state and national lottery regulations, responsible gaming standards, and emerging policy trends
- Support audit preparation, certification documentation, and regulatory reviews
- Prepare policy summaries, briefing notes, and internal communications
- Help maintain organized, audit-ready compliance and CSR documentation
- Track corrective actions, risk considerations, and documentation updates
- Support research on responsible gaming best practices and player protection strategies
- Assist in reviewing and refining responsible gaming messaging and player-facing resources
- Contribute to development of content for websites, retailer materials, and training tools
- Support awareness initiatives, education campaigns, and stakeholder presentations
- Assist with CSR reporting, metrics tracking, and data summaries
